What is PDTR and How Does It Work?


PDTR stands for Proprioceptive Deep Tendon Reflex, a technique rooted in functional neurology that examines and corrects imbalances in the body's proprioceptive system—the network of sensory receptors that inform the brain about movement, position, and balance. Unlike traditional physical therapies that might focus solely on muscles or joints, PDTR treats the nervous system's "software," reprogramming how the body responds to stimuli. It uses muscle testing, neural challenges, and reflex assessments to identify dysfunctional receptors that send aberrant signals to the central nervous system, leading to pain, weakness, or restricted movement.


The method was pioneered by Dr. Palomar through years of research in neurology, biomechanics, physiology, anatomy, and Applied Kinesiology. Practitioners apply gentle, manual techniques to reset these reflexes, often resulting in immediate improvements. For instance, it's described as a "reflexogenic system" that efficiently treats a wide spectrum of functional problems. Training in PDTR includes foundational courses on functional neurology, intermediate levels for biomechanical analysis, and advanced modules covering viscera, nerve entrapments, and metabolic dysfunctions.


Research supporting PDTR includes electromyography (EMG) studies demonstrating its effects on neuromuscular patterns, as well as case studies showing corrections in chronic conditions. One report highlights how PDTR restores afferent information flow to the nervous system, aiding rehabilitation. While more large-scale clinical trials are needed, existing evidence points to its efficacy in addressing neurological dysfunctions.


How Chiropractors Use PDTR to Benefit Patients


Chiropractors increasingly incorporate PDTR into their practices as a complementary tool to traditional spinal adjustments, enhancing their ability to address neuromuscular dysfunctions at a deeper neurological level. This integration allows chiropractors to use PDTR's precise diagnostic techniques, such as muscle testing and neural challenges, to identify and reset faulty sensory receptors that contribute to pain, misalignment, and restricted movement. For example, chiropractors apply PDTR to correct vertebral subluxation complexes by resetting the primary neurological information causing the dysfunction, often achieving instant improvements without invasive procedures.


In sports chiropractic, PDTR is used to treat athletes with issues like labral tears, hip tendinitis, or postpartum mobility problems, where it helps restore proper muscle coordination and reduce pain rapidly. Chiropractors trained in PDTR follow structured education paths, including Foundations for basic functional neurology, Intermediate for advanced joint analysis, and Advanced for systemic issues like nerve entrapments and metabolic dysfunctions, enabling them to offer holistic care.


Patients benefit significantly from this approach: it maximizes balance and stability, accelerates recovery from injuries, and provides long-term pain relief by treating root causes rather than symptoms. For instance, chiropractic patients with chronic back tightness or concussion symptoms report reduced tension, improved function, and a gentle, painless experience that complements spinal adjustments. Overall, chiropractors leverage PDTR to enhance patient outcomes, promoting a pain-free life through neurological reprogramming integrated with chiropractic principles.
